Plastic Injection Molding Operator
The Plastic Injection Molding Operator is responsible for inspecting, finishing, and documenting injection-molded plastic parts produced by molding machines. This role requires strong attention to detail, the ability to follow written and verbal instructions, and a commitment to quality and safety in a production environment.
Key Responsibilities
-
Trim excess plastic (flash) from molded parts as required
-
Clean parts to meet quality and customer specifications
-
Perform visual and basic mechanical inspections following written and verbal instructions
-
Sort parts according to quality standards and production requirements
-
Apply labels, zip ties, or other components as instructed
-
Accurately record accepted and rejected parts at the molding machine
-
Maintain a clean and organized work area
-
Follow all safety, quality, and production procedures
